P208.18-26   Good mornings of good old lust, early shutters open to
the sea, winds coming in with the heavy brushing of palm leaves, the
wheezing break to surface and sun of porpoises out in the harbor.
“Oh,” Katje groans, somewhere under a pile of their batistes and
brocade, “Slothrop, you pig.”
“Oink, oink, oink,” sez Slothrop cheerfully. Seaglare dances up on the
ceiling, smoke curls from black-market cigarettes. Given the
precisions of light these mornings, there are forms of grace to be
found in the rising of the smoke, meander, furl, delicate fade to
clarity. . . .

What does "the precisions of light" mean?  What does it mean to say
light is "precise"?
